    Maybe you're not listening to the right people. Climatologists admit that water vapor is a major part of climate, but it is a feedback, not a forcing. Atmospheric water vapor only changes in response to temperature, so something else must cause temperatures to rise in the first place.

Let us consider the following differences. Antarctic land ice is the ice which has accumulated over thousands of years on the Antarctica landmass itself through snowfall. This land ice therefore is actually stored ocean water that once fell as precipitation. Sea ice in Antarctica is quite different as it is ice which forms in salt water primarily during the winter months. When land ice melts and flows into the oceans global sea levels rise on average; when sea ice melts sea levels do not change measurably..
